Odor is often the first sign Allenton customers notice, well before any visible water shows up.
Stair-step cracks in block foundations are a common early warning sign we see across Allenton-area homes.
It's easy to dismiss efflorescence as harmless dust, but it actually signals active moisture movement through the wall.
A sump pump that never stops cycling is often working harder than it should, or is undersized for your Allenton lot's water table.
A bowing basement wall is a structural concern in addition to a water one — this is the kind of Allenton call we prioritize fast.
Peeling paint low on a basement wall or warped baseboards upstairs often trace back to moisture migrating up from below.
